3D-Programmierung von CAD/CAM software

Wir bieten erstklassige Experten für die Entwicklung und Implementierung von 3D-Softwarelösungen mit Open CASCADE Technologien. Unsere Spezialisten unterstützen Ihre Projekte im Bereich CAD/CAM-Programmierung mit maßgeschneiderten und innovativen Lösungen.

  • Home
  • > Development services >
  • CAD/CAM Entwicklung

01

DIENSTLEISTUNGEN

Unsere Dienstleistungen auf Basis der Open CASCADE-Technologie

3D Development auf Kundenanfrage

Individuelle Entwicklung von 3D-Anwendungen, Modellen oder Softwarelösungen nach den spezifischen Anforderungen des Kunden.

Vollständiger CAD/CAM-Entwurfs- und Berechnungszyklus

Umfassende Planung und Berechnung für die Produktion mithilfe von CAD/CAM-Systemen, angepasst an spezifische Anwendungsbereiche.

Verstärkung von Ihrem bestehenden Entwicklungsteam mithilfe unserer 3D-Experten.

Wenn Sie erfahrene 3D-Programmierer für die Entwicklung von CAD- und CAM-Software benötigen, sind Sie hier genau richtig. Unsere C++-Entwickler mit Fokus auf 3D-Geometrieverarbeitung bieten spezialisierte Entwicklung von 3D-Lösungen zur Umsetzung Ihrer Ideen.

02

projekte

Unsere Experten haben aktiv an CAD/CAM-Projekten in verschiedenen Bereichen mitgewirkt:

SCOPE (Semantic Construction Project Engineering)

Das Projektkonsortium hat erste vollständige Bauelementbeschreibungen in den Web-Formaten RDF und OWL abgebildet. Dafür wurden die Funktionalitäten des Geometriekernels OpenCASCADE in adressierbare Webstrukturen überführt. Das SCOPE-Team hat die Anwendung erfolgreich erprobt und damit den Rohbau des Stuttgarter Konzerngebäudes Z3 dargestellt.

Kegelrad-Geometrie für CNC-Maschinen

Die Entwicklung von Kegelrad-Geometrie für CNC-Maschinen erfordert präzise CAD/CAM-Technologien zur Modellierung und Fertigung komplexer Zahnradformen.
CAD/CAM-Experten optimieren die Geometrie und übertragen die CAD-Modelle auf CNC-Maschinen, um eine hohe Präzision und Funktionalität der Zahnräder zu gewährleisten.

C3D-Geometrie-Kernel

Der C3D-Geometrie-Kernel ist eine Softwarebibliothek für die Entwicklung von CAD/CAM/CAE-Anwendungen. Er bietet Funktionen zur 3D-Geometrieerstellung, -bearbeitung und -analyse und wird als Kernkomponente in vielen CAD-Systemen verwendet.

C3D wird oft als Alternative zu anderen Geometrie-Kernen wie OpenCASCADE, ACIS oder Parasolid genutzt und eignet sich für CAD/CAM-Software, technische Simulationen und CNC-Programmierung.

Gravursoftware

CAD/CAM-Expertise ist entscheidend für die Entwicklung von Gravursoftware, die präzise 3D-Gravuren auf CNC-Maschinen ermöglicht. Mit diesen Technologien können komplexe Geometrien und Muster effizient erstellt und auf Materialien wie Metall, Kunststoff und Holz exakt bearbeitet werden, was eine hohe Genauigkeit und Wiederholbarkeit in der Produktion gewährleistet.

Dental-CAD-Systeme

Dental-CAD-Systeme ermöglichen die präzise Planung und Fertigung von Zahnersatz, wie Kronen und Brücken. CAD/CAM-Experten spielen eine Schlüsselrolle bei der Entwicklung und Optimierung dieser Systeme, um genaue 3D-Modelle zu erstellen und die Produktion auf CNC-Maschinen zu steuern. Dadurch wird eine hohe Passgenauigkeit und Effizienz in der Zahnmedizin erreicht.

Bergmann Infotech und unsere CAD/CAM-Experten sind stets offen für neue Herausforderungen und Erfahrungen.

Wir sind bereit, innovative Projekte zu unterstützen und uns auch in bisher unerforschte Bereiche vorzuwagen. Mit unserer Expertise und Flexibilität bringen wir kreative Lösungen, um neue Technologien und Ansätze erfolgreich umzusetzen.

02

PROJECTS

Unsere Experten haben aktiv an CAD/CAM-Projekten in verschiedenen Bereichen mitgewirkt:

SCOPE (Semantic Construction Project Engineering)

Das Projektkonsortium hat erste vollständige Bauelementbeschreibungen in den Web-Formaten RDF und OWL abgebildet. Dafür wurden die Funktionalitäten des Geometriekernels OpenCASCADE in adressierbare Webstrukturen überführt. Das SCOPE-Team hat die Anwendung erfolgreich erprobt und damit den Rohbau des Stuttgarter Konzerngebäudes Z3 dargestellt.

Gravursoftware

CAD/CAM-Expertise ist entscheidend für die Entwicklung von Gravursoftware, die präzise 3D-Gravuren auf CNC-Maschinen ermöglicht. Mit diesen Technologien können komplexe Geometrien und Muster effizient erstellt und auf Materialien wie Metall, Kunststoff und Holz exakt bearbeitet werden, was eine hohe Genauigkeit und Wiederholbarkeit in der Produktion gewährleistet.

C3D-Geometrie-Kernel

Der C3D-Geometrie-Kernel ist eine Softwarebibliothek für die Entwicklung von CAD/CAM/CAE-Anwendungen. Er bietet Funktionen zur 3D-Geometrieerstellung, -bearbeitung und -analyse und wird als Kernkomponente in vielen CAD-Systemen verwendet.

C3D wird oft als Alternative zu anderen Geometrie-Kernen wie OpenCASCADE, ACIS oder Parasolid genutzt und eignet sich für CAD/CAM-Software, technische Simulationen und CNC-Programmierung.

Kegelrad-Geometrie für CNC-Maschinen

Die Entwicklung von Kegelrad-Geometrie für CNC-Maschinen erfordert präzise CAD/CAM-Technologien zur Modellierung und Fertigung komplexer Zahnradformen.
CAD/CAM-Experten optimieren die Geometrie und übertragen die CAD-Modelle auf CNC-Maschinen, um eine hohe Präzision und Funktionalität der Zahnräder zu gewährleisten.

Dental-CAD-Systeme

Dental-CAD-Systeme ermöglichen die präzise Planung und Fertigung von Zahnersatz, wie Kronen und Brücken. CAD/CAM-Experten spielen eine Schlüsselrolle bei der Entwicklung und Optimierung dieser Systeme, um genaue 3D-Modelle zu erstellen und die Produktion auf CNC-Maschinen zu steuern. Dadurch wird eine hohe Passgenauigkeit und Effizienz in der Zahnmedizin erreicht.

Bergmann Infotech und unsere CAD/CAM-Experten sind stets offen für neue Herausforderungen und Erfahrungen.

Wir sind bereit, innovative Projekte zu unterstützen und uns auch in bisher unerforschte Bereiche vorzuwagen. Mit unserer Expertise und Flexibilität bringen wir kreative Lösungen, um neue Technologien und Ansätze erfolgreich umzusetzen.

03

TECH Stack

Unser Tech Stack für geometrische 3D Modellierung

Unser Team verwendet Open CASCADE Technology und Open Graphics Library (OpenGL) sowie einige andere der fortschrittlichsten Entwicklungsansätze.

Unit tests

GTest

Language C++

C++/C++11/C++14/
C++17/C++20

Containers / Algorithms

STL, boost

CAD/CAM 3D

OpenCascade, IFC OpenShell

Ein Beispiel zur Berechnung der benötigten Betonmenge für einen Bodenbelag.

04

CAD/CAM

Was ist CAD / CAM software?

Computer-aided design software (CAD)

CAD bezeichnet die Unterstützung von konstruktiven Aufgaben mittels EDV zur Herstellung eines Produkts. Welche Tätigkeiten unter den Begriff CAD fallen, wird in der Literatur verschieden behandelt. In einem engeren Sinn versteht man unter CAD das rechnerunterstützte Erzeugen und Ändern des geometrischen Modells.

Computer-aided manufacturing software (CAM)

CAM bezeichnet die Verwendung einer von der CNC-Maschine unabhängigen Software zur Erstellung des NC-Codes und ist ein Teilaspekt der Fertigungstechnik bzw. Arbeitsvorbereitung. Mittels des NC-Codes werden beispielsweise spanabhebende Maschinen oder 3D-Drucker angesteuert.

Die verwendeten Open CASCADE Technologien

Open CASCADE Technology (OCCT) ist Software Development Kit (SDK) mit einer objektorientierten C++ Klassenbibliothek, die Dienste für 3D-Flächen- und Volumenmodellierung, CAD-Datenaustausch und Visualisierung bietet.

04

OCCT Anwendung

Weitere mögliche Anwendungsbereiche der Open CASCADE-Technologie (OCCT)